Allu Arjun’s Pushpa was a surprise hit in Bollywood. The way it fared shocked even the trade pundits and now the wait is on for the second part.
But there is not much news about the sequel. We have come to know that the sequel will begin its shoot in the month of July in the Maredumalli forests.
Close to 400 crores are being spent on this film and the shoot will be wrapped up by January 2023. What’s special is that Mythri Movie Makers will be holding back the Hindi release rights of the film.
As there is a solid buzz for the film India-wide, they have decided to hold back the Hindi rights. Sukumar is done with the story and is penning the screenplay as of now.
